Transaction 256f8422bce60d6a42fb7bb2c51e72d13b341c5d6e1a6657f19872409ced2ab3
1 Input
1 Output
-
256f8422bce60d6a42fb7bb2c51e72d13b341c5d6e1a6657f19872409ced2ab3:0
- value
- 712360389
- script pubkey
- OP_0 OP_PUSHBYTES_20 3edc936a372b7a11d063b864ae67a169c7c49231
- address
- bc1q8mwfx63h9dapr5rrhpj2ueapd8rufy33ypkjtg